# Env Vars: Planner Regression Mitigation

After the query planner regression in Corvid DB 9.3, Fernwell's release builds must pin the legacy planner until the patched build ships. Set `CORVID_PLANNER_MODE=legacy` in the release env file and confirm it with the preflight check before tagging. The planner override endpoint requires authentication, so the release env file also needs the planner override token on the next line.

env line for kahof-fajeg: ARCHIVE_KEY3=397

Subject: Lost badge procedure — reminder

Hi night team, quick refresher from the Thornquay front desk. If someone reports a lost badge overnight, log it in the security binder, deactivate it via the Gatewarden console, and issue a paper temporary pass valid until 09:00. Verify identity against the staff roster before issuing anything. Lost badges found later go in the grey drop box. To unlock the temporary-pass drawer, enter the code below.

door code, yagap-bahof: bdg-O-05

Subject: Queue log compaction — handover

Welcome aboard. Compaction on the Brindlemere queue runs every 6h via cron on the relay box. If segment files on the `ordersfeed` topic exceed 40GB, run the manual sweep script in /opt/brindle/tools before paging anyone. Offsets checkpoint to the metrics DB, not the broker. Dashboards read from the same store. Connect to it with the string below.

warehouse DSN: mssql://rusdor_svc:0FSWCn9@db-951a.paliqforge.local:5432/ulawyn